Research Notes on Diabetes and Alpha-Lipoic Acid
Alpha lipoic acid (ALA) also known as thioctic acid, is a powerful, natural antioxidant, which converts blood sugar into energy. ALA has been found helpful in treating diabetic neuropathies.1 Alpha lipoic acid can also help the body use glucose, which may have the potential in improving blood sugar control.2
Fast Facts:
- ALA is a fatty acid that is found naturally inside every cell your body.3
- Alpha lipoic acid is the only antioxidant that is both fat- and water-soluble. 2
- Besides being useful for diabetes, ALA has also been proven beneficial fo treating AIDS and burning mouth syndrome.4
